#
# Set tmpfs vars
#
# Get size of physical RAM in kiB
ram_size ()
{
[ -r /proc/meminfo ] && \
grep MemTotal /proc/meminfo | \
sed -e 's;.*[[:space:]]\([0-9][0-9]*\)[[:space:]]kB.*;\1;' || :
}
# Get size of swap space in kiB
swap_size ()
{
[ -r /proc/meminfo ] && \
grep SwapTotal /proc/meminfo | \
sed -e 's;.*[[:space:]]\([0-9][0-9]*\)[[:space:]]kB.*;\1;' || :
}
#
# Get total VM size in kiB. Prints nothing if no RAM and/or swap was
# detectable.
#
vm_size ()
{
RAM=$(ram_size)
SWAP=$(swap_size)
RAM="${RAM:=0}"
SWAP="${SWAP:=0}"
echo $((RAM + SWAP))
return 0;
}
#
# Get size of tmpfs. If the size is absolute or a percentage, return
# that unchanged. If suffixed with "%VM", return the absolute size as
# a percentage of RAM and swap combined. If no swap was available,
# return as a percentage (tmpfs will use a percentage of RAM only).
#
tmpfs_size_vm ()
{
# Handle the no-swap case here, i.e. core memory only. Also handle no
# memory either (no proc) by just returning the original value.
RET="$1"
VMTOTAL="$(vm_size)"
VMPCT="${RET%\%VM}"
if [ "$VMPCT" != "$RET" ]; then
if [ -n "$VMTOTAL" ]; then
RET=$(((VMTOTAL / 100) * VMPCT))
RET="${RET}k"
else
RET="${VMPCT}%"
fi
fi
echo "$RET"
}
# Free space on /tmp in kiB.
tmp_free_space ()
{
LC_ALL=C df -kP /tmp | grep -v Filesystem | sed -e 's;^[^[:space:]][^[:space:]]*[[:space:]][[:space:]]*[0-9][0-9]*[[:space:]][[:space:]]*[0-9][0-9]*[[:space:]][[:space:]]*\([0-9][0-9]*\)[[:space:]][[:space:]]*.*$;\1;'
}
# Check if an emergency tmpfs is needed
need_overflow_tmp ()
{
[ "$VERBOSE" != no ] && log_action_begin_msg "Checking minimum space in /tmp"
ROOT_FREE_SPACE=$(tmp_free_space)
[ "$VERBOSE" != no ] && log_action_end_msg 0
if [ -n "$ROOT_FREE_SPACE" ] && [ -n "$TMP_OVERFLOW_LIMIT" ] \
&& [ $((ROOT_FREE_SPACE < TMP_OVERFLOW_LIMIT)) = "1" ]; then
return 0
fi
return 1
}
# Set defaults for /etc/default/tmpfs, in case any options are
# commented out which are needed for booting. So that an empty or
# outdated file missing newer options works correctly, set the default
# values here.
RAMLOCK=yes
# These might be overridden by /etc/default/rcS
if test -z "${RAMSHM}" ; then
# tmpfs can not be used for shm yet, see #923078
case "$(uname -s)" in
(GNU) RAMSHM=no ;;
(*) RAMSHM=yes ;;
esac
fi
if [ -z "$RAMTMP" ]; then RAMTMP=no; fi
TMPFS_SIZE=20%VM
TMPFS_MODE=755
RUN_SIZE=10%
RUN_MODE=755
LOCK_SIZE=5242880 # 5MiB
LOCK_MODE=1777
SHM_SIZE=
SHM_MODE=1777
TMP_SIZE=
TMP_MODE=1777
TMP_OVERFLOW_LIMIT=1024
# Source conffile
if [ -f /etc/default/tmpfs ]; then
. /etc/default/tmpfs
fi
TMPFS_SIZE="$(tmpfs_size_vm "$TMPFS_SIZE")"
RUN_SIZE="$(tmpfs_size_vm "$RUN_SIZE")"
LOCK_SIZE="$(tmpfs_size_vm "$LOCK_SIZE")"
SHM_SIZE="$(tmpfs_size_vm "$SHM_SIZE")"
TMP_SIZE="$(tmpfs_size_vm "$TMP_SIZE")"
RUN_OPT=
[ "${RUN_SIZE:=$TMPFS_SIZE}" ] && RUN_OPT=",size=$RUN_SIZE"
[ "${RUN_MODE:=$TMPFS_MODE}" ] && RUN_OPT="$RUN_OPT,mode=$RUN_MODE"
LOCK_OPT=
[ "${LOCK_SIZE:=$TMPFS_SIZE}" ] && LOCK_OPT=",size=$LOCK_SIZE"
[ "${LOCK_MODE:=$TMPFS_MODE}" ] && LOCK_OPT="$LOCK_OPT,mode=$LOCK_MODE"
SHM_OPT=
[ "${SHM_SIZE:=$TMPFS_SIZE}" ] && SHM_OPT=",size=$SHM_SIZE"
[ "${SHM_MODE:=$TMPFS_MODE}" ] && SHM_OPT="$SHM_OPT,mode=$SHM_MODE"
TMP_OPT=
[ "${TMP_SIZE:=$TMPFS_SIZE}" ] && TMP_OPT=",size=$TMP_SIZE"
[ "${TMP_MODE:=$TMPFS_MODE}" ] && TMP_OPT="$TMP_OPT,mode=$TMP_MODE"
